Financial Analyst - Corporate Accounting
The Corporate Financial Analyst is responsible for accounting and financial support of Armada's corporate shared services functions and day-to-day treasury activities. This role serves as a key contributor to the monthly close process, corporate cost accounting, cash management, financial analysis, and process improvement initiatives.
The ideal candidate is a self-starter who takes ownership of responsibilities, identifies opportunities for improvement, and delivers results with minimal supervision. This analyst has a broad understanding of gener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P), along with a desire to research, passion for problem-solving, and a questioning mind.
Primary Responsibilities - Corporate Accounting
- Maintain accurate general ledger records in compliance with US GAAP.
- Perform monthly close activities including journal entries, reconciliations, accruals, and variance analysis.
- Account for and monitor corporate shared service costs and allocations.
- Assist with preparation of consolidated financial reporting and ad hoc analyses.
- Manage processing of capital assets and respective depreciation within fixed asset accounting system.
Primary Responsibilities - Treasury and Cash Management
- Execute daily treasury activities including cash positioning, monitoring, and fund transfers.
- Maintain cash forecasts and assist in updating liquidity reporting models.
- Record and reconcile cash transactions within the ERP system; update cash roll-forwards and reconcile to General Ledger.
- Identify opportunities to improve treasury processes and reporting.
Financial Analysis and Process Improvement
- Perform routine financial analyses to identify trends, risks, and opportunities.
- Analyze monthly departmental spending and prepare budget-to-actual reporting.
- Support and complete ad hoc analyses and projects related to Armada corporate shared services and other related expenses.
- Support annual budgeting and forecasting processes.
- Recommend and implement process improvements and internal control enhancements.
- Support system implementations, automation efforts, and special projects.
